6-Hydroxykaempferol 3,6-diglucoside

6-Hydroxykaempferol 3,6-diglucoside
6-Hydroxykaempferol 3,6-di-O-glucoside and 6-hydroxykaempferol 3,6,7-tri-O-glucoside can inhibit platelet aggregation induced by collagen, they also show weak inhibitory effects on the adenosine 5'-diphosphate (ADP)- induced platelet aggregation.

In vitro
Four constituents, 6-hydroxykaempferol 3,6,7-tri-O-glucoside (1), 6-hydroxykaempferol 3-O-rutinoside-6-O-glucoside (2), 6-hydroxykaempferol 3,6-di-O-glucoside (6-Hydroxykaempferol 3,6-diglucoside,3), and syringin (4) were isolated from the flower of Carthamus tinctorius L. and were examined for the inhibitory effects on platelet aggregation. The platelet aggregation was monitored by a platelet aggregometer employing a laser-scattering method. The compounds were identified on the basis of NMR spectral data.
Chemical Properties
Molecular Weight626.52
FormulaC27H30O17
Cas No.142674-16-6
